hello. Could you please give me any information that you know on black himalayan salt , pink himalayan salt and sodium chloride especiallly on their minerals and vitamins and their history. I would also like to know what they do for the body. Thank you

-All salts are mostly sodium chloride and work the same in the body. 1)Table salt (iodized): Contains iodine (important for thyroid health). -Best choice nutritionally. 2)Pink Himalayan salt: Has tiny amounts of minerals (iron, magnesium), but not enough to matter. No iodine unless added. 3)Black Himalayan salt (kala namak): Similar to pink salt, with sulfur compounds that give an egg-like smell. Used mainly for flavor, not health. -For the body: Salt helps with hydration, nerves, muscles, and blood pressure. Too much can raise blood pressure. -so, Use iodized salt regularly for health; use pink or black salt for taste and variety.

Black Himalayan Salt (Kala Namak) Minerals: Iron, sulfur, magnesium, calcium, potassium Vitamins: None Simple Benefits: Helps digestion Reduces gas and bloating Pink Himalayan Salt Minerals: Iron, potassium, magnesium, calcium (very small amounts) Vitamins: None Simple Benefits: Helps fluid balance Supports muscles and nerves Table Salt (Sodium Chloride) Minerals: Sodium and chloride Extra: Often contains iodine Vitamins: None Simple Benefits: Needed for body fluid balance Helps thyroid (because of iodine)
